    Mike, an eye wall replacement cycle. The storm will soon lose its inner eye and it will be replaced by an outer larger eye. That eye will then start to shrink and she'll start to pick up some steam once again.

    Hurricane Rita Intermediate Advisory Number 20a
    Nws Tpc/national Hurricane Center Miami Fl
    1 Pm Cdt Thu Sep 22 2005

    ...rita Weakens A Little Further...remains An Extremely Dangerous
    Hurricane...

    A Hurricane Warning Is In Effect From Port O'connor Texas To Morgan
    City Louisiana. A Hurricane Warning Means That Hurricane Conditions
    Are Expected Within The Warning Area Within The Next 24 Hours.
    Preparations To Protect Life And Property Should Be Rushed To
    Completion.

    A Tropical Storm Warning Remains In Effect From South Of Port
    O'connor To Port Mansfield Texas And For The Southeastern Coast Of
    Louisiana East Of Morgan City To The Mouth Of The Mississippi
    River. A Tropical Storm Warning Means That Tropical Storm
    Conditions Are Expected Within The Warning Area Within The Next 24
    Hours.

    A Tropical Storm Watch Is In Effect From North Of The Mouth Of The
    Mississippi River To The Mouth Of The Pearl River Including
    Metropolitan New Orleans And Lake Pontchartrain...from South Of
    Port Mansfield To Brownsville Texas...and For The Northeastern
    Coast Of Mexico From Rio San Fernando Northward To The Rio Grande.
    A Tropical Storm Watch Means That Tropical Storm Conditions Are
    Possible Within The Watch Area...generally Within 36 Hours.

    For Storm Information Specific To Your Area...including Possible
    Inland Watches And Warnings...please Monitor Products Issued
    By Your Local Weather Office.

    At 1 Pm Cdt...1800z...the Center Of Hurricane Rita Was Located Near
    La ude 25.5 North...longitude 89.2 West Or About 435 Miles...700
    Km...southeast Of Galveston Texas And About 430 Miles...695 Km...
    Southeast Of Port Arthur Texas.

    Rita Is Moving Toward The West-northwest Near 9 Mph...15 Km/hr. A
    Gradual Turn To The Northwest Is Expected During The Next 24 To 36
    Hours.

    Data From A Noaa Reconnaissance Aircraft Indicate That Maximum
    Sustained Winds Have Decreased To Near 150 Mph...240 Km/hr... With
    Higher Gusts. Rita Is Now A Strong Category Four Hurricane On
    The Saffir-simpson Scale. Some Slight Weakening Is Forecast During
    The Next 24 Hours But Rita Is Expected To Remain An Extremely
    Dangerous Hurricane.

    Hurricane Force Winds Extend Outward Up To 85 Miles...140 Km...
    From The Center...and Tropical Storm Force Winds Extend Outward Up
    To 185 Miles...295 Km.

    Latest Minimum Central Pressure Reported By A Noaa Hurricane Hunter
    Plane Was 915 Mb...27.01 Inches.

    Coastal Storm Surge Flooding Of 15 To 20 Feet Above Normal Tide
    Levels...along With Large And Dangerous Battering Waves...can Be
    Expected Near And To The East Of Where The Center Makes Landfall.
    Tides Are Currently Running About 2 Foot Above Normal Along The
    Mississippi And Louisiana Coasts In The Areas Affected By Katrina.
    Tides In Those Areas Will Increase Up To 3 To 4 Feet And Be
    Accompanied By Large Waves...and Residents There Could Experience
    Some Coastal Flooding.

    Rainfall Ac ulations Of 8 To 12 Inches With Isolated Maximum 15
    Inch Total Are Possible Along The Path Of Rita Particularly Over
    Southeast Texas And Western Louisiana. In Addition...rainfall
    Amounts Of 3 To 5 Inches Are Possible Over Southeastern Louisiana
    Including New Orleans. Based On The Forecast Track...rainfall
    Totals In Excess Of 25 Inches Are Possible After Rita Moves Inland.

    Repeating The 1 Pm Cdt Position...25.5 N... 89.2 W. Movement
    Toward...west-northwest Near 9 Mph. Maximum Sustained Winds...150
    Mph. Minimum Central Pressure...915 Mb.

    The Next Advisory Will Be Issued By The National Hurricane Center At
    4 Pm Cdt.

    Forecaster Avila
